4 Tactics to Win and Retain End-of-Lease Customers
Are you ready for the glut of lease vehicles about to hit the market?
According to J.D. Power, nearly 2 million vehicles are coming off lease over the next five months. Attracting and selling to end-of-lease customers is a huge opportunity to emerge stronger from the current market downturn.
